Inhibition of Hydroxyapatite Growth , by Glycosaminoglycans,lucosamine being the most potent inhibitor. The results clearly suggest that the chemical structure of the glycosaminoglycans determines their behavior in inhibiting HAP crystal growth. The presence of N-acetylglucosamine, and of only one sulphate ester group in the axial position, seemed to be the most prominent.
